- The distance between Mafraq, Jordan and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, Usa is approximately 9,333 km or 5,799 mi.
- To reach Mafraq in this distance one would set out from Philadelphia, Pennsylvania bearing 52.2°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Mafraq bearing 134.1° or SE .
- Mafraq has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k) whereas Philadelphia, Pennsylvania has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Mafraq is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ome whereas Philadelphia, Pennsylvania is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 4.2 °C (7.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.2 °C (14.8°F) less in Mafraq.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 901.8 mm (35.5 in) less which is equivalent to 901.8 l/m² (22.13 US gal/ft²) or 9,018,000 l/ha (964,084 US gal/ac) less. About 1/7 as much.
- There are 822 more hours of sunlight per year in Mafraq. In whichever way circa 2h 14' more per day or about 1 1/3 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.5° higher in Mafraq than in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.
- Relative humidity levels are 1.2%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 3.7°C (6.7°F) higher.
